That's why bringing down fuel consumption and thus CO₂ emissions is key. To combat climate change in line with the Paris Agreement, the first carbon dioxide emissions regulations for new heavy-duty vehicles (HDV) has been introduced. These will mean cutting average CO₂ emissions from new heavy-duty vehicles by 15% by 2025 and by 30% by 2030 compared to 2019/2020. To ensure there is a standardisation in measurement of CO₂ emissions across the industry, the European Commission has introduced a simulation tool called VECTO — short for Vehicle Energy Consumption Calculation Tool.

Using our premium hot retreading service ContiRe™, you give new life to your worn Continental truck tyre and realise the full economic performance of the tyre. ContiRe™ production is compatible to how we manufacture our new tyres – using the same profiles and compound mixtures. Exclusively we use Continental casings, which are retreaded from bead to bead. This method also renews the sidewalls, and the tyres remain regroovable.
To ensure a premium finish, every tyre is put through durability and safety tests in adherence to a standardised quality system. Consequently, every ContiRe™ tyre is covered by our warranty. All this coupled with outstanding mileage makes our ContiRe™ the best choice of retreadable tyre.
